How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Redmond Town Center?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Redmond Town Center Studio Apartments | $1,983 | $1,195 | $2,790 |
| Redmond Town Center 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,918 | $1,440 | $6,158 |
| Redmond Town Center 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,805 | $1,995 | $5,315 |
| Redmond Town Center 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,288 | $2,425 | $5,481 |
How much does it cost to rent a home in Redmond Town Center?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2 Bedroom Homes | $2,897 | $2,245 | $3,400 |
| 3 Bedroom Homes | $3,383 | $2,800 | $3,700 |
